Gameplay and Features
Lightning online roulette follows the same basic rules as traditional roulette, with players placing bets on where they think the ball will land on the spinning wheel. However, what sets this version apart is the addition of randomly generated Lucky Numbers and Lucky Payouts. Once the betting round is over, lightning strikes between one and five random numbers on the betting grid, each receiving a multiplier between 50x and 500x. If the ball lands on a Lucky Number and a player has placed a bet on it, their winnings are multiplied accordingly.
This unique feature adds an element of excitement and anticipation to each spin, as players wait to see if the lightning will strike in their favor. With the potential for massive multipliers, Lightning online roulette offers the chance for big wins that can’t be found in traditional roulette.

House Edge and Payouts
The house edge in Lightning online roulette varies depending on the specific rules of the game and the casino you are playing at. On average, the house edge is around 2.70% for European roulette and 5.26% for American roulette. However, with the addition of Lucky Payouts in Lightning roulette, the house edge can increase significantly. It is important to understand the odds and payouts of each bet to make informed decisions while playing.
